如何在GitHub上获得你的第一个星标:最佳实践与策略

在开源社区中,GitHub不仅是一个代码托管平台,更是一个展示个人技能和项目的舞台。获得第一个星标对于每一个开发者而言都是一个重要的里程碑。那么,如何才能在GitHub上成功获取你的第一个星标呢?本文将详细探讨这一话题。

1. 什么是GitHub星标?

在GitHub上,星标(Star)是用户对项目的认可。它不仅表明了用户对该项目的关注,也反映了项目的受欢迎程度。拥有多个星标的项目往往更容易被其他开发者发现,并可能吸引更多的贡献者。

1.1 星标的意义

  • 认可:获得星标意味着其他用户认可你的项目。
  • 曝光率:星标数量越多,项目在搜索结果中的排名越高。
  • 贡献者吸引:更多的星标可以吸引更多的开发者参与进来。

2. 如何提高获取星标的概率?

为了获得第一个星标,你可以采取以下策略:

2.1 精心准备项目

  • 清晰的项目目标:确保你的项目有明确的功能和目标。
  • 完善的文档:良好的README文档可以帮助用户更好地理解你的项目。
  • 用户友好:提供易于安装和使用的说明,提升用户体验。

2.2 积极推广

  • 社交媒体:利用Twitter、Facebook等社交平台分享你的项目。
  • 开发者社区:在相关论坛、社区发布项目链接,寻求反馈。
  • 写博客:通过技术博客分享项目的开发过程和技术细节。

2.3 参与开源社区

  • 贡献其他项目:参与其他项目的开发,可以增加你的曝光率,吸引更多人查看你的GitHub主页。
  • 加入GitHub组织:通过参与一些知名的开源组织,提升自己在社区中的影响力。

3. 如何提升项目的质量?

优质的项目更容易获得星标,以下是一些建议:

3.1 代码质量

  • 遵循编码规范:保持代码整洁,使用标准化的编码风格。
  • 编写测试用例:确保代码的功能性和稳定性。

3.2 持续更新

  • 定期更新:根据用户反馈和技术发展,定期更新项目。
  • 处理Issues:积极响应和处理用户提交的issues,提升用户满意度。

4. 常见问题解答(FAQ)

4.1 如何知道我的项目是否被关注?

可以通过查看GitHub项目页面右侧的统计信息,了解项目的星标数量和fork数量。

4.2 如何提高项目的能见度?

  • 关键词优化:在项目描述和README中使用相关的关键词。
  • 发布更新:定期发布项目更新和新功能,吸引用户再次关注。

4.3 有没有推荐的平台可以分享我的GitHub项目?

  • Dev.to:这是一个开发者社区,可以分享技术文章和项目。
  • Reddit:在相关的subreddit中分享项目。

4.4 有哪些工具可以帮助我管理GitHub项目?

  • GitHub Projects:可以用来管理项目的进度。
  • Travis CI:持续集成工具,确保代码质量。

4.5 如何处理负面反馈?

负面反馈是成长的一部分,积极响应,倾听用户的意见,并持续改进项目,可以赢得更多用户的信任。

结论

获得你的第一个星标不仅是对你努力的认可,更是打开新机会的大门。通过优化项目质量、积极推广和参与社区,你可以大大提高获得星标的概率。希望以上策略能帮助你在GitHub上获得第一个星标,开启你的开源之旅!

正文完